Crypto 2029: The Ultimate Prediction of the Four-Year Cycle in the Encryption Industry

Crypto 2029: A Four-Year Cycle Forecast This analysis predicts key developments in the cryptocurrency industry from 2025 to 2029, arguing that the sector's evolution will be defined by legal and regulatory shifts, not just technology. By mid-2026, a market for perpetual futures contracts on private companies (like SpaceX) on platforms like Hyperliquid emerges as the primary venue for pricing premium assets, overshadowing speculative altcoins. The "AI + Crypto" narrative fades as AI companies operate successfully without blockchain. Meanwhile, a quiet institutional adoption of tokenized traditional assets (like money market funds) begins under new regulations like the CLARITY Act. In 2027, major public blockchain foundations pivot decisively to serve institutional clients, building compliance infrastructure. However, three sectors hit ceilings: private company perpetuals due to advertising restrictions, stablecoins due to political uncertainty ahead of the 2028 US election, and tokenization due to cautious scaling. The 2028 US election (assuming a Democratic win) reduces regulatory uncertainty. A major liquidation event in the private company perpetuals market exposes the flaw of synthetic derivatives lacking a legally enforceable underlying asset. In response, regulators ease rules, allowing the open marketing of secondary private equity shares to verified accredited investors. This creates a legal, direct market for assets previously only accessible via synthetic contracts. By 2029, a new bull market is driven by trading in real private equity shares of innovative companies (biotech, robotics, AI). Tokens without legal claims to real assets lose all liquidity. Stablecoin growth is steady but politically capped. Speculative crypto trading shrinks to a niche. Cryptocurrency's role as financial infrastructure becomes invisible and mundane, akin to back-end settlement systems. The three core questions are answered: Token value derives from legal claims to real assets. Frontier tech adopts crypto via private market trading channels. Crypto's integration into traditional finance becomes complete and unremarkable. The central, testable prediction is that by late 2028, legal pathways for mainstream investor access to private assets will have opened; if not, this entire forecast fails.

The World Cup Has Only Just Begun, But AI Predictions Already Have Models Hailed as 'Godly' and Others Flipping Over

After only a few days of the World Cup, AI models are being widely used for match predictions, with mixed early results. These models analyze details like scores, upsets, red cards, and key players, offering users in prediction markets an extra layer of analysis beyond odds and news. Qwen gained early attention for its remarkably accurate calls on the opening day, correctly predicting Mexico's 2-0 win over South Africa and Korea's 2-1 victory over the Czech Republic, while also highlighting red card risks and match flow. Copilot had its own highlights, accurately forecasting the Mexico 2-0 result, the Korea 2-1 win, and a surprising 1-1 draw between Brazil and Morocco. However, it also misjudged several matches, like predicting a Swiss win that ended in a draw with Qatar and missing Australia's upset over Turkey. ChatGPT provided detailed pre-match analysis and correctly called the Mexico 2-0 score, explaining factors like home-field advantage. Yet, it struggled to anticipate upsets, often siding with the stronger team on paper, as seen in its missed calls for the Australia-Turkey and Japan-Netherlands matches. Social media tests pitted models like Gemini, Grok, and Claude against each other for the same games, revealing different predictive "scripts" even for the same fixture. Overall, while AI models like Qwen and Copilot have shown promising, high-profile successes in early matches, their consistency and ability to predict genuine upsets remain in question. As the tournament progresses, more data will be needed to determine which models offer the most reliable insights for prediction markets.

Someone Predicts South Korean Stock Market with Hyperliquid, Achieving 74% Accuracy?

A study analyzed whether weekend price movements of four Korean stock perpetual futures contracts (Samsung Electronics, SK Hynix, Hyundai Motor, and EWY) on Hyperliquid could predict their Monday opening directions on their respective primary exchanges (KRX, NYSE). Over 62 weekend observations across the four assets, Hyperliquid correctly predicted the Monday opening direction 45 times (73.8% accuracy). However, performance varied significantly. Samsung Electronics showed the strongest and statistically significant signal, with Hyperliquid's weekend close correctly predicting its KRX Monday open in 15 out of 16 cases (94% accuracy, p-value < 0.001). This signal remained strong (75% accuracy) even when using Saturday's close instead of Sunday's, suggesting genuine price discovery beyond last-minute convergence. Hyundai Motor also showed high accuracy (81%, 13/16 correct), but this was not statistically significant after accounting for a baseline downward bias in its Monday opens. SK Hynix performed marginally better than a coin flip (63%, 10/16). EWY performed the worst (54%, 7/13), underperforming a simple strategy of always predicting a Monday rise. The stark difference between Samsung and EWY is largely attributed to market timing. KRX opens shortly after Hyperliquid's Sunday close, while NYSE opens ~14 hours later, allowing new information to flow in. The results suggest that for assets like Samsung Electronics, where weekend trading on Hyperliquid precedes the primary market open by only minutes, the platform can provide a valuable predictive signal worth monitoring before the Monday auction, despite the currently small weekend trading volumes.
